Promise Six To Give You Peace



"Don't fret or worry. Instead of worrying, pray. Let petitions and praise shape your worries into prayers, letting God know your concerns. Before you know it, a sense of God's wholeness will come and settle you down. It's wonderful what happens when Christ displaces worry at the center of your life." (The Message)

And there it is again. DON'T FRET! Isn't it canny how the Word goes right to one of our major battles in life? DON'T WORRY! Sounds condemning, but it's not. Rather than beat us down, Paul finds reveals a way for us to redirect our energy. We are to turn our fright in to fight. We're to transform anxiety into an acknowledgement of the mighty power of God.

There was an old hymn I grew up with that was themed with a great admonition. "Take it to the Lord in prayer. In his arms he'll take and shield thee, take it to the Lord in prayer." Maybe you forgot the words. Just hum a few bars. That will do just fine. The fact is, we find our solace, our peace, our strength, and our victory within the presence of the Living God. We get their through prayer and praise.

Don't settle for a little folding of the hands in worry. Go for the upraised hands of one who knows his God. Worry will most definitely be displaced when you do.
